ResCap working with FTI to avoid covenant breach as near-term bonds plunge Mar 20, 2008
ResCap, the residential lending arm of GMAC, is working with FTI Consulting on a plan to pledge assets to the companys currently unsecured credit facility, said two sources familiar and two buysiders. Management intends to use that security as a carrot to convince lenders to waive an anticipated breach of the credit agreements minimum net worth covenant, they said. (FT.com -- Markets)

Vulture Fund Makes Deal With Delinquent Homeowners Fleeing Subprime Devil Feb 29, 2008
Servicing is where the rubber meets the road,'' says Ron Greenspan, senior managing director at Baltimore-based FTI Consulting Inc. The company acted as an adviser to creditors in the bankruptcies of lenders including Irvine, California-based New Century Financial Corp., the biggest subprime mortgage lender to seek court protection. If you do it right, it'll give you an opportunity to maximize how you manage your investment in loans,'' Greenspan says. (Bloomberg)

Sunrise Provides Status Report on Special Independent Committee Investigation; Provides Updates on Management's Internal Control Review Efforts and on Legal Proceedings Sep 29, 2007
In support of the investigation, WilmerHale engaged FTI Consulting, Inc. and Huron Consulting Group, forensic accounting firms, to provide technical accounting guidance and analysis, as well as to assist with document collection and review, interview support, and transaction review. The Special Independent Committee has now concluded the fact-finding portion of its investigation with respect to three issues. (PR Newswire)

Viacom's Expensive Suit Mar 29, 2007
The two mammoth antitrust cases waged by the U.S. Justice Department against IBM (nyse: - - ) and Microsoft (nasdaq: - - ), says Mark Rasch, a managing director at FTI Consulting (nyse: - - ), an economic, forensic and litigation consulting group. The IBM case, which began in 1969 and stretched on until 1982, generated some $200 million in fees, as well as 950 depositions and trial witnesses, 726 days of trial, 17,000 exhibits, and 104,400 pages of trial transcripts. (Forbes -- Technology)
